In last Sunday's loss to the New York Jets, Cardinal DE Darnell Dockett was pretty adamant about the team's decision to let the Jets score late in the game so the Cards would have enough time to score a TD and a 2-pt conversion to send the game into overtime. He got so heated that he both said it and sprayed it in the direction of teammate Kerry Rhodes.
